Spinach Salad with Sun Dried Tomatoes
Ingredients:
1-1/2 tsp mustard
1/4 cup croutons
1/4 tsp salt to taste (optional)
2 cups mushrooms, sliced
2-1/2 tbsp olive oil
1-1/2 tbsp red wine vinegar
1/4 cup sun dried tomatoes, drained and chopped
1 lb spinach leaves, washed and torn into pieces, tough stems discarded
1 clove garlic, crushed
Cooking Directions:Combine spinach, mushrooms and tomatoes in a salad bowl. Combine remaining ingredients except croutons in a jar with a tight-fitting lid. Season with pepper to taste and shake vigorously. Pour dressing over spinach and toss. Serve with croutonsNutritionist Recommended For: |
